SN75119D Overview
This component is manufactured by the company Texas Instruments and falls under the category of Interface - Drivers, Receivers, Transceivers. It is a chip used for interfacing and communication purposes. The weight of this chip is approximately 72.603129mg and it is marked as Pbfree, meaning it does not contain any lead. The Moisture Sensitivity Level (MSL) of this chip is 2, which indicates that it can withstand moderate levels of moisture for up to 1 year. The Terminal Finish of this chip is Nickel/Palladium/Gold (Ni/Pd/Au), which is a type of coating used for protection and improved conductivity. The Peak Reflow Temperature (Cel) for this chip is 260, which is the maximum temperature it can be exposed to during the manufacturing process. The Nominal Supply Current is 60mA, which is the amount of current required for the chip to function properly. This chip has 3-STATE output characteristics, meaning it can be in three different states: high, low, or off. It has a driver and receiver with 1 bit each, and a total of 1 transceiver.
